The University of Alaska Human Resources department is seeking an HRIS Analyst 1 or 2 (Grade 79 or Grade 80) to join our Human Resources Information Systems, Data Analytics, and Budget team. This is a range recruitment, final placement will depend on the candidate’s qualifications and experience.

The HRIS Analyst works within the HR Information Systems, Data Analytics, and Budget team, a group of analytical and driven professionals who provide technical, data, and financial expertise to support HR operations across the university system. We are a collaborative and supportive team that values family, flexibility, and professional growth. This position will collaborate across the HR department and with the Information Technology department to design, implement, and maintain efficient, compliant, and user focused HRIS solutions that enhance data integrity, streamline processes, and support strategic organizational goals.

To thrive in this role, you will bring curiosity, analytical thinking, and a customer focused mindset to solving HRIS and process challenges. You will translate between technical and functional teams, develop user stories and acceptance criteria, support systemwide testing and implementation efforts, and help ensure compliance with HR policies, collective bargaining agreements, and federal/state regulations.

As an HRIS Analyst 1, you will support technically complex projects, assist with testing and implementations, conduct research, build foundational HRIS knowledge, and help troubleshoot day to day issues.

As an HRIS Analyst 2, you will take on more complex and independent responsibilities, including leading or supporting major systemwide initiatives, performing advanced root cause analysis, crafting process improvements, mentoring peers, and bridging functional and technical requirements at a deeper level.

Placement at the 1 or 2 level will depend on experience, skills, and demonstrated competencies.

Minimum Qualifications

HRIS Analyst 1 (Grade 79, HR Professional 3)

Bachelor’s degree in Human Resources or related field and two years professional human resources experience, or an equivalent combination of training and experience. Professional in Human Resources (PHR) certification preferred.

HRIS Analyst 2 (Grade 80, HR Professional 4)

Bachelor’s degree in Human Resources or other related field and three years progressively responsible professional human resources experience, or an equivalent combination of training and experience. Professional in Human Resources (PHR) certification preferred.

Minimum of two years of progressively responsible experience in Human Resources, Business, or Information Technology fields.
